Attenton 1X drive train fanatics!!! This is your huckleberry!This deraillieur saved my monster-cross build. Let's face it, most of the components available for a cross bike are too fragile. You can no longer mix 10 spd mountain and road Shimano components due to the dyna-sys shift ratio being different. Sooo...I solved my 1x10 drivetrain issue with this. I changed the jockey wheels out for some higher end sealed bearing units. Most people believe a 9spd rear mech won't work with a 10 spd shifter...this is wrong. It works fantastically!I'm using a Retro-shift CX 10spd shimano shifter with this 9spd rear mech with updated jockey wheels. I'm using a 42T chain ring with a 11-36 rear 10 spd mountain cassette, 10 spd chain. As far as the rear mech 9spd label-- it speaks to the width of the chain it can handle, not the size of the rear cassette. This rear mech was easy to adjust and shifts effortlessly with positive, crisp shifts. I wanted a clutch style XT rear 10spd mech but the shift ratio won't work with my drop bar monster cross Vassago Fisticuff build. But this turned out to be a great fix! While it doesn't have a clutch, the unit has fantastic rear spring tension and has not dropped the chain. Far more tension than the 105 rear road mech I was using. I'm running a Wolff tooth components front chain ring. This allowed a nice clean build without the hassle of a front mech and double front crank. The gearing has enough steam to sprint respectably in the flats or road, and is very capable in most climbing situations. The climb has to be very extreme before this setup has you walking. If you want to guarantee super climbing ability switch to a 39T chainring, you'll lose some steam in the flats but it's still good for about 22mph. The setup is a compromise, but it is simple and it flat out works. I would say with this exception, most 9spd / 10spd component mixes won't work, but this particular assembly of parts is perfect!
